TEL AVIV, Israel & SAN FRANCISCO – Vayyar Imaging, the 3D imaging sensor company whose technology makes it possible to see through objects, today announced it has closed a $45 million Series C financing round co-led by Walden Riverwood and ITI with additional funding from Claltech and follow-on investment from Battery Ventures, Bessemer Ventures, Israel Cleantech Ventures, and Amiti, bringing total capital raised to date to $79 million USD. Vayyar will use the funds to expand into new industries, grow its global team and diversify its sensing product offerings. Click here to see a video about Vayyar's sensor capabilities.

Vayyar’s sensors create a 3D image of everything happening around you in realtime, without the use of a camera. These sensors can see through solid objects, map large areas and can be used in privacy-sensitive locations where optics cannot. Providing a look beyond human vision, Vayyar's sensors have expanded across industry sectors, including smart home, automotive, retail, robotics, medical, construction, agriculture and more. About Walden Riverwood

Walden Riverwood Ventures, a venture capital firm focused on investing in core technology companies was formed as a collaboration between Walden International, a leading international venture capital firm and Riverwood Capital, a global, technology-focused private equity firm. Walden's founding partners provide its portfolio companies with unique access to deep industry knowledge, relationships and management experience.
